Image is one of the best ways to communicate the message. Many users have secret information to communicate so this privacy is generated by the combined watermarking and cryptography. Firefly and Blowfish algorithms are used to get the optimistic results. The simulation should be suitable for the images we consider. Many researchesprove that watermarking and cryptography are combined but it depends on the images parameters. This paper combines firefly with blowfish algorithms which are simulated in MATLAB to generate promising features. This is simulated with the lighting features of fireflies. Generally fireflies are more attractive to each other in the greater intensity values. Two major processes is considered one is attraction and other is grouping. Factors like SSIM and bit error rates are calculated.
